What is the When To Sleep Calculator?
The When To Sleep Calculator is a tool designed to help you calculate optimal sleep times based on sleep cycles. Each sleep cycle lasts approximately 90 minutes, and waking up at the end of a cycle ensures you feel more rested and energized. The calculator also allows you to specify the number of sleep cycles you want to complete, giving you personalized results tailored to your schedule.

Practical Example
Suppose you need to wake up at 7:00 AM tomorrow and want to complete 5 sleep cycles. The Sleep Calculator will calculate backward from 7:00 AM, subtracting 90 minutes per cycle. The recommended sleep times might look like this:
- 11:30 PM
- 10:00 PM
- 8:30 PM
- 7:00 PM
- 5:30 PM
If you choose 6 sleep cycles, it will add one more 90-minute interval, allowing you to sleep longer while still waking up at the right point in your cycle.
This approach helps prevent grogginess and improves alertness, mood, and cognitive performance.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. What is a sleep cycle?
A sleep cycle is a 90-minute period of sleep consisting of light, deep, and REM sleep phases.
2. How many sleep cycles should I get per night?
Most adults benefit from 5–6 cycles (7.5–9 hours of sleep).
